Chicken Alfredo Bake: A Creamy and Delicious Comfort Food Recipe


  • Author: tessa
  • Total Time: 50 minutes
  • Yield: 6 servings 1x

Description

This Chicken Alfredo Bake features creamy Alfredo sauce, tender rotini pasta, juicy chicken, and vibrant broccoli, all topped with melted mozzarella and Parmesan. It’s a comforting, cheesy dish perfect for family dinners or meal prep, sure to please everyone at the table!


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 cups cooked rotini pasta
  • 2 cups cooked chicken, shredded or diced
  • 2 cups broccoli florets (fresh or frozen)
  • 1 cup Alfredo sauce (store-bought or homemade)
  • 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il (if using fresh broccoli)
  • Fresh parsley for garnish (optional)

**Instructions:**

1. **Cook the Chicken**: If not already cooked, boil, grill, or bake the chicken until fully cooked. Season with salt, pepper, and Italian seasoning. Let cool, then shred or dice.

2. **Prepare the Broccoli**: Wash and cut fresh broccoli into florets. Blanch in boiling salted water for 2-3 minutes until bright green and slightly tender. Transfer to ice water to stop cooking. If using frozen, thaw according to package instructions.

3. **Boil the Pasta**: In a large pot, bring salted water to a boil. Add rotini pasta and cook according to package instructions until al dente (about 8-10 minutes). Stir occasionally.

4. **Drain the Pasta**: Drain the pasta in a colander, reserving about 1/4 cup of pasta water.

5. **Prepare the Sauce (if homemade)**: Melt 1/2 cup unsalted butter in a saucepan over medium heat. Add 2 cups heavy cream and bring to a gentle simmer. Stir in 1 cup grated Parmesan cheese, 2 minced garlic cloves, and season with salt and pepper. Cook for about 5 minutes until slightly thickened.

6. **Mix Everything Together**: In a large bowl, combine cooked pasta, shredded chicken, blanched broccoli, and Alfredo sauce. Add garlic powder, Italian seasoning, and season with salt and pepper. If too thick, add reserved pasta water to reach desired consistency.

7. **Preheat the Oven**: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).

8. **Prepare the Baking Dish**: Lightly grease a 9×13 inch baking dish with cooking spray or olive oil.

9. **Layer the Mixture**: Pour the pasta mixture into the prepared baking dish, spreading evenly.

10. **Add Cheese**: Sprinkle shredded mozzarella and grated Parmesan cheese evenly over the top.

11. **Bake**: Bake in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es, until cheese is melted and bubbly, and edges are golden. For a crispier top, broil for an additional 2-3 minutes, watching closely.

12. **Let it Rest**: Allow the dish to sit for 5-10 minutes after baking to set.

13. **Garnish and Serve**: Garnish with freshly chopped parsley if desired. Serve warm, alongside a side salad or garlic bread.

**Notes:**
– For a homemade Alfredo sauce, adjust the garlic and cheese to your taste.
– This dish can be made ahead of time and stored in the refrigerator before baking.
